Output 2f68ffa656d7caff29e443fb2143876a30ee7f1adb384f7b4759cdf2a11b8232:0

value
86397588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8bcf5a81a53bf562a21e17815c7ade97bebd7ab OP_EQUAL
address
3QNDsG4yKuyGmtNL3mB3z2LtpuUV7om4xQ
transaction
2f68ffa656d7caff29e443fb2143876a30ee7f1adb384f7b4759cdf2a11b8232
confirmations
346776
spent
true